Tom M. June 21, 2011 for Model Number lsb6200kq0 How do I take the top off to replace the lid safety switch?
1 Answer Hello Tom. You will need to remove the screws in the back corners of the control panel and flip the panel backwards. Then remove the wires going to the lid switch and the two brass colored clips. The cabinet will pull forward and slide off the unit. You can now access the lid switch. Reinstall in reverse order. Lou May 23, 2011 for Model Number LSR7133KQ0 Is replacing the lid switch on a Whirlpool LSR7133KQ0 a difficult process? Is it something a homeowner can do?
1 Answer Hello Lou! Replacing that lid switch is actually fairly easy. After removing the top panel of the washer, the switch is held in by a few screws on a bracket. Remove those, unplug the old switch, and then plug in the new one. Robert April 26, 2011 for Model Number RTW4340SQ0 Washer continues to fill up and overflows if the top is left open. This has happened 3 times within the last 3 weeks. What's the problem and can I fix it?
1 Answer Hello Robert. Usually when the washer overfills you have to replace the pressure switch W10339251. The lid switch is a safety device used to stop the unit spinning once the door is opened. Hope this helps! Read More...
